Most of roof leakages in Mantoloking, New Jersey are caused by relatively common situations that damage your roof.

  • Your roof will never ever have a bad day, yet aging is inescapable. All roofing materials are prone to harsh weather such as rainstorms, freeze/thaw cycles, heats, and extreme summertime sun, which might eventually trigger premature aging, splitting, and curling of the shingles.
  • Brick chimneys seem strong, however the mortar that holds the bricks together, in addition to the flashing and chimney crown, can be readily ruined. Water might get into the attic through cracks, corrosion, and punctures.
  • A leak can be easily triggered by missing or broken shingles. Individual shingle replacement is usually not a major issue, but failing to get it repaired might result in more damaged shingles and more costly repairs.
  • The vents on your roof system contain exposed fasteners that will fracture, degrade, and age with time. This is a small repair, but it is a normal source of leaks due to the fact that the majority of vents do not last the life of the roof.
  • The pipes boot slips over a pipeline to secure the pipe’s connection to the roof. The boot, like the vents and flashing, can be damaged, fracture, and fail. The repair isn’t particularly hard, although damage can be quickly overlooked.
  • Storm damage, strong winds, and hail might all cause large and little holes. Some holes are evident, however others may go unnoticed for many years till an examination reveals them. Water can enter through even small holes caused by misplaced roofing nails, the removal of an antenna or dish mounting bracket, or impact-related fissures in roofing products.
  • A complex, convoluted roofline might be rather enticing, however it is also harder to waterproof. Every joint, valley, and slope must be marked.
  • Roof products struggle to hold up against freeze-thaw cycles, in addition to ice and snow. Water may sneak into microscopic areas between and under shingles when snow builds up, melts, and refreezes. Water swells and deepens the fracture as it freezes. The weight of the snow and ice can also trigger bending and drooping of the flashing and plywood foundation.
  • Gutters may posture difficulties if they are not cleaned and fixed on a regular basis. Rainwater can support behind a clog and penetrate through the shingles, harming the wood underneath. Standing water can likewise trigger damage to older seamless gutters.
  • Skylights, like chimneys and pipe vents, have some of the exact same issues. Aside from potential flashing damage, the rubber or vinyl seals around skylights may dry up and fracture; at this point, the skylight must be changed.
  • Wetness can develop in your attic as a result of ventilation problems, and this can mimic a roof leak. In order to effectively leave warm air and moisture from your attic location, your roof needs to have sufficient consumption and exhaust ventilation. This can result in wood rot, mold, and damaged insulation, and it has the prospective to be a really costly repair.

The greatest protection against roof leaks is to schedule a yearly roof inspection and to act quickly if you suspect a leak.
